The Hyperfine Spin Splittings In Heavy Quarkonia

The hyperfine spin splittings in heavy quarkonia are studied using the recently developed renormalization group improved spin-spin potential which is independent of the scale parameter μ. The calculated energy difference between the J/ψ and the ηc fits the experimental data well, while the predicted energy difference ∆Mp between the center of the gravity of 1 P0,1,2 states and the 1P1 state of charmonium has the correct sign but is somewhat larger than the experimental data. This is not surprising since there are several other contributions to ∆Mp, which we discuss, that are of comparable size (∼ 1 MeV) that should be included, before precise agreement with the data can be expected. The mass differences of the ψ − η c, Υ(1S)− ηb, Υ(2S)− η ′ b, and B c −Bc are also predicted. PACS numbers: 12.39.Pn, 12.38.Cy, 12.38.Lg, 12.39.Hg
